Mastering the Art of Cooking on a Waffle Iron Griddle

The key to cooking on a waffle iron griddle lies in the right temperature. You want it hot enough to brown the food but not so hot that it burns.

The technique of flipping is crucial. Wait for the edges to set and the surface to bubble before gently lifting and turning your pancakes or waffles.

Using a non-stick spray or oil is a must. It prevents sticking and ensures your creations come out cleanly.

Seasoning the griddle with a bit of butter or cooking spray can add a rich flavor to your breakfast treats.

Don’t overcrowd the griddle. Give each item enough space to cook evenly. It’s a common mistake that leads to uneven cooking.

Practice patience. It takes a few minutes for the griddle to heat up and for food to cook properly. Rushing can lead to undercooked or overdone results.

Experiment with different batter consistencies and toppings. The griddle is forgiving and can handle a variety of ingredients and textures.

Cleaning and Maintenance: Keeping Your Griddle in Top Shape

After cooking, let your griddle cool down naturally before cleaning. This prevents any water from causing damage.

Use a non-abrasive sponge or cloth to wipe away any residue. Avoid using harsh chemicals or abrasive pads that can scratch the surface.

For stubborn stuck-on food, a little bit of hot water can help loosen it up. Be gentle to prevent damaging the non-stick coating.

Always dry the griddle thoroughly after cleaning to prevent rust, especially if it’s made of metal.

Store your griddle in a cool, dry place. A protective cover can help keep it dust-free and prevent scratches.

Regularly check the griddle for any signs of wear, like cracks or peeling, and replace it if necessary. Maintenance is key to extending its life.

If you notice any rust spots, gently sand them away with a fine-grit sandpaper and apply a thin coat of cooking oil to prevent future rust.
